Special Issue on Program Transformation

Science of Computer Programming

Guest Editor Ralf L�mmel

Call for contributions

The special issue is devoted to `program transformation' in the broader
context of software maintenance. That is, program transformation is 
meant here in the sense of automated program adaptation by executable
transformations. Such transformations are used in software maintenance 
but also in software development in various ways, e.g., for refactoring,
software migration, mass maintenance, change logging, schema evolution,
aspect weaving, and others. The special issue seeks high-quality
contributions studying the following dimensions of transformations:

    * formal aspects
      such as operator suites for transformations and their properties;

    * language design issues
      such as suitable language setups and meta-programming frameworks;

    * infra-structural issues
      such as the relation to front-ends, program analysis, interfaces;

    * software engineering aspects
      such as scaling, testing and maintaining transformations;

    * emerging fields
      such as unanticipated software evolution;

    * case studies
      such as lessons learned in large-scale transformation projects.
